Jacobs and Koivula lead after five draws (PHOTO GALLERY)

Jacobs rolls to win over Chandler.

Defending Olympic Champion Brad Jacobs and the Thunder Bay rink skipped by Colin Koivula are tied for top spot after five draws at the 2016 Travelers Men’s Northern Ontario Championships taking place at the Granite Club this weekend.  

Both teams are tied for top spot at 4-1.  

The only local team, skipped by Mattawa’s Patrick Gelinas is well behind at 1-4.  

This morning Jacobs scored three in the first end and cruised to an 8-3 win over the Jordan Chandler rink out of Sudbury.  

In the most dramatic contest of the day fifth draw, the Robbie Gordon rink out of Sudbury battled back from a 6-1 deficit after 6 ends to win their first game 9-6 over the young Sudbury area team skipped by 17-year-old Tanner Horgan. The loss drops Horgan, out of Copper Cliff, to 2-3.
